The synthesis of the photochemical probes 6 and 7 is described. These photoprobes are analogues of dolichol and dolichol phosphate, obligatory intermediates in the N-linked glycosylation pathway in the endoplasmic reticulum. 描述了光化学探针 6 和 7 的合成。这些光探针是多萜醇和多萜醇磷酸盐的类似物,是内质网中 N-连接糖基化途径中的必需中间体。6 和 7 的合成遵循一个新的策略。它涉及单萜类羟基磺酰基二价阴离子与烯丙基氯的顺序烷基化。光反应性基团 3-(三氟甲基)-3-芳基二氮丙啶与完全组装的聚异戊二烯链的 β-异戊二烯基单元的羟基化甲基相连。可光活化的多萜醇类似物 6 是酵母膜多萜醇激酶的底物,酵母膜是 N-连接糖基化途径中必不可少的酶。
